
As FundRaising Success gears up for the ninth annual Gold Awards for Fundraising Excellence, take a look back at the 2012 Special Events Campaigns of the Year from MIND Research Institute and Avow Hospice, both of which took home gold, as well as the Lions Eye Institute for Transplant & Research, which took home silver.
The MIND Research Institute's Calling All Superheroes Awards Gala was a huge hit, generating $448,000 overall at a cost to raise a dollar of 4 cents and an average gift of $5,600. Avow Hospice's 2011 Butterfly Weekend brought in nearly $123,000 with an average gift of $275 and a cost to raise a dollar of 25 cents.
Meanwhile, the Lions Eye Institute's Eye Ball Gala, which had all expenses covered by sponsors, generated $185,000. Talk about successful events.
